However, experts in this field are still hesitant about making climate change a central focus in general approaches to economic theory. Although climate change is discussed in the fields of environmental economics and circular economy, there are gaps regarding the political economy of this area. The aim of this book is to discuss the connections between climate change and political economy in the policy-making process. Climate Change, Circular Economy, and Industry: Economic Approaches and Policy Implications examines, discusses, and critiques how industry and other sectors are affected by climate change and the circular economy. It further draws policymakers' attention to the inseparable aspects of climate change from economic policies. Covering topics such as climate change, the circular economy, waste management, and industrial policies, this book is a valuable resource for academics, researchers, policymakers, climate researchers, and graduate students. Communities around the world are facing growing challenges from climate change and increasing waste, yet these challenges also present powerful opportunities for transformation. Improving resilient communities means equipping people with the knowledge and systems needed to adapt and lead sustainable change. By integrating renewable energy solutions and effective waste management, communities can reduce environmental impacts and enhance social well-being. Empowering Resilient Communities Through Climate Action, Renewable Energy, and Waste Management explores how climate change and its consequences affect citizens and governments. It examines global sustainable policies and strategies that could be implemented to combat climate change. Covering topics such as renewable energy, climate change, and waste management, this book is an excellent resource for academicians, researchers, policy makers, climate researchers, and graduate students.
